The Rise of Menswear for Women

The concept of women wearing menswear is not a new one. Coco Chanel is often credited with pioneering the trend in the early 20th century, when she famously borrowed items from her boyfriend’s wardrobe and incorporated them into her designs. Since then, we’ve seen menswear for women become a staple in the fashion industry, with designers like Yves Saint Laurent and Ralph Lauren making it a key part of their collections.

In recent years, the androgynous trend has gained even more momentum, with women ditching traditional dresses and skirts in favor of menswear-inspired pieces like tailored blazers and wide-legged trousers. This shift in fashion reflects a larger cultural movement towards gender fluidity and breaking down traditional gender norms.

How to Choose the Right Tailored Blazer

When shopping for a tailored blazer, there are a few key things to keep in mind to ensure you find the perfect one for you.

1. Pay Attention to Fit

A well-fitted blazer is essential when it comes to achieving a polished and put-together look. Look for blazers that are tailored at the waist to accentuate your curves, and make sure the shoulders fit properly without any gaping or bunching.

2. Consider the Material

The material of the blazer can make all the difference in terms of both look and comfort. For a more feminine look, opt for softer materials like wool or cashmere. If you want to add a touch of masculinity, a structured wool or tweed blazer is the way to go.

3. Think About the Details

When it comes to tailored blazers, it’s all about the little details that can make a big impact. Look for blazers with interesting buttons or unique lapel styles to add a touch of personality to your outfit.
